The New Hampshire Mountain Kings are a Tier II junior ice hockey team playing in the North American Hockey League. The Mountain Kings play their home games in the Tri-Town Ice Arena in Hooksett, New Hampshire.

History

In 2023, after a group of local investors purchased the Tri-Town Ice Arena, the NAHL announced that they had accepted the New Hampshire Mountain Kings as a new expansion franchise.[3] About a month later, the team selected Cam Robichaud to be their first head coach.[4] The new bench boss quickly set about putting a team together and getting them ready for the inaugural game on September 13, 2023.

The Mountain Kings also have an affiliate team that plays in the NA3HL (Tier-III) called the New Hampshire Jr. Mountain Kings.[5]

Season-by-season records

Season GP W L OTL SOL Pts GF GA Regular Season Finish Playoffs
2023–24 60 20 35 5 0 45 148 214 8th of 9, East
28th of 32, NAHL
Did Not Qualify
2024–25 59 27 29 2 1 57 201 210 6th of 10, East
23rd of 35, NAHL
Lost Play-in series, 1–2 (Maine Nordiques)
